Civilization and the Kardashev Scale
The Agnirva program also delves into the fascinating concept of the Kardashev scale, a framework for categorizing the
technological advancement of civilizations based on their ability to harness energy. Interns will explore the implications of
this scale, discussing the potential for humanity to achieve higher levels of energy production and utilization, and the
societal and technological transformations that could accompany such progress. They will also consider the ethical and
philosophical questions that arise as civilizations grapple with the challenges and responsibilities of becoming a Type I, II, or
III civilization on the Kardashev scale.
